IV. With God as your fortress, you can experience true peace!
Therefore, since we have been justified by faith, we have peace with God through our Lord Jesus Christ. Romans 5:1
Do not be anxious about anything, but in everything by prayer and supplication with thanksgiving let your requests be made known to God. And the peace of God, which surpasses all understanding, will guard your hearts and your minds in Christ Jesus. Philippians 4:6–7
· Peace with God – Objective (His peace is real whether we feel it or not.)
· The Peace of God – Subjective (We feel His peace.)
· Peace in your relationships – Peace among the nations
· God is at work to bring peace to your life, peace with Him and peace with others!
